Biography

Lucy Ann Briggs. [1][2][3][4][5][6]

Born 1826 Allegany County, New York, USA. [7][8][9][10][11][12]

Residence 1850 Independence, Allegany, New York, USA. [13] 1855 Independence, Allegany, New York, USA. [14] Note: Relation to Head of House: Wife. 1860 Nelson, Madison, New York. [15] 1870 Lysander, Onondaga, New York, USA. [16] Note: Post Office: Baldwinsville. 1 JUN 1875. Lysander, Onondaga, New York, USA. [17] Note: Relation to Head of House: Wife. 1880 Plainville, Onondaga, New York, USA. [18] Note: Marital Status: MarriedRelation to Head: Wife.
